The Kerala High Court yesterday quashed a criminal case registered by the Police under the Foreigners Act against two Pakistani nationals who came to Kochi on a valid medical visa. The court also directed the Police to issue them clearance certificates within three days to enable them to travel back to Karachi via Chennai. The Pak nationals, Imran Mohammed along with his attendant Ali Asghar could not leave the country from Chennai airport earlier, due to lack of police clearance certificate after their treatment in Kochi.

When approached for the certificate, the Kerala Police registered a criminal case against them. Quashing the criminal case, the court observed that such action brought ignominy to the country’s policing system. It said, the ground for the registration of the crime was totally unfounded and illegal. The court noted that when foreign nationals are involved, officers should show a little more sensibility and act cautiously.
